Kellie Pickler’s flirty relationship with Simon Cowell during the fifth season of “American Idol” certainly raised a lot of eyebrows, especially when the controversial judge referred to the blonde belle as a “naughty minx.” At the time tabloid reports even suggested that their bonding caused problems with Cowell’s then-girlfriend Terri Seymour — thus it’s no wonder Pickler is feeling both nervous yet excited about making a guest appearance on the FOX show this Wednesday night.

“I haven’t seen Paula, Randy or Simon since I was last on Idol,” Pickler told Tarts on Sunday. “But everyone keeps saying that it’s easier for me going back on and not being judged, but everybody judges me. It’s harder — there are higher expectations now.”

But we are starting to wonder how the country crooner managed to make it to sixth place on the show in the first place, as apparently Cowell can’t understand her Southern speak and she can’t catch his British banter.

“Simon and I always have fun together, but what’s hilarious is the communication barrier,” Pickler said. “He can’t understand what I say and I don’t understand what he says.”

Oh, but she hasn’t forgotten the “naughty minx” reference …

“Trust me, I’ve been called much worse,” she said.
